Posted by tranquil
The need of pixels are, off course, depending on what pictures are ment for. Taking a picture with your phone to MMS to friends doesn't require much whilst medical, or spacetechnology, a fraction more. Saying that, pixels aren't everything; camera optics are just as important. 37 megapixels with T68i optics would be a bit of a waste.
